International Cup 2026: Can Machine Learning Accurately Predict the Outcome ?

The next World Cup in 2026, co-presented across several nations, is generating considerable excitement. But beyond the athlete performances and thrilling matches, a new inquiry arises: Can computer intelligence effectively forecast the final champion? Cutting-edge AI systems are being created to analyze enormous amounts of data , including athlete form, previous match results , and even team tactics . Although these impressive tools can spot relationships humans might miss, utterly precise prediction remains a significant hurdle . Factors like unforeseen injuries, officiating decisions, and sheer fortune can often impact the direction of a competition .

  • Statistics volume and quality are critical .
  • Model bias can distort results.
  • Unpredictable events are unfeasible to account for.
Therefore, while AI provides useful perspectives , it's improbable to deliver a complete prediction of the 2026 World Cup champion.
